Ticket demand for the Rugby League World Cup got off to a flying start this week, when the tournament launched their priority access sale.  

The team at RLWC2021 have confirmed that all 61 matches at next years tournament have had applications which includes each respective men’s, women’s and wheelchair tournaments that will run in unison.

In addition, as a thankyou to the UK’s key workers there were large numbers of key workers logging on as applications opened for free tickets here. Launched back in the height of the pandemic the team wanted to reward everyone’s tireless work in protecting and supporting local communities during the COVID-19 pandemic.

The Rugby League Family includes the RLWC2021 database of fans, previous Rugby League ticket buying customers, key workers, volunteers and associated partners.
